  • RTP, the Portuguese national broadcaster, has confirmed that it will be participating in this year's Junior Eurovision Song Contest in Warsaw, Poland. 

    RTP confirmed, in statements to Escportugal, which will be competing at the Eurovision Junior 2020 competition.Without revealing any details about the choice of Portugal's representative in the competition RTP just ensured that "if there is a competition, RTP will be present", taking into account  the evolution of the Covid-19 pandemic. It should be noted that Poland, the host country for this year's competition, recently announced the lifting of transportation restrictions for passengers from Portugal.

     

    Portugal in Junior Eurovision

    Debuting in 2006, Portugal has a total of five participations in the contest in the edition of 2006-2007 and 2017-2019, with the best result being the 14th place of Pedro Madeira and Mariana Venâncio in 2006 and 2017, respectively. 

    Last year in Gliwice, the country was represented by Joana Almeida and "Vem comigo (Come with Me)", finishing in 16th place with 43 points, all from the online vote.
